The Role of RNG( Random Number Generators )Trust is the ultimate currency in iGaming. To make sure reasonable play, digital casino video games rely greatly on advanced Random Number Generators. These algorithms make sure that every spin ofa virtual slot or turn of a card is completely random and independent of previous outcomes. Leading iGaming business subject their RNGs to extensive screening by independent, recognized testing agencies such as eCOGRA or iTech Labs. Platform Architecture: In-House vs. White Label When launching or scaling an iGaming brand name, leadership deals with a vital architectural choice: White-Label Solutions: The company leases an entire turnkey platform from a service provider. This provides a fast time-to-market withlower in advance expenses, however limits modification and earnings margins. Proprietary Platforms: - The company constructs its software from scratch. While costly and time-consuming, this grants amount to control over the user experience, proprietary features, and long-term scalability. 3. Navigating the Complex
- Web of Regulation Few industries deal with the regulatory scrutiny that iGaming does. Because money moves throughout borders immediately, and due to the fact that the industry touches sensitive issues surrounding problem gambling, compliance is probably the most vital
department in any modern-day iGaming company. Runninglegally requires acquiring licenses from acknowledged jurisdictions. These variety from strict regional regulators (such as the UK Gambling Commission or the New Jersey Division of Gaming Enforcement )to wider global bodies (like the Malta Gaming Authority or Curaçao eGaming). Key Compliance Measures Geolocation: Ensuring players are physically located within a jurisdiction where online gambling is legal. Age Verification: Implementing stringent protocols to obstruct minors from accessing real-money games. Accountable Gambling Tools: Providing users with tools to set deposit limitations, take cooling-off durations, or self-exclude completely. - Regulative bodies impose massive fines-- and can withdraw licenses-- if business stop working to secure susceptible players. 4. titles from their preferred video game studio. 5. Payments, Risk Management, and Security Moving cash globally, securely, and quickly is a massive logistical obstacle. An iGaming business needs to integrate dozens of payment gateways-- spanning charge card, e-wallets, bank transfers, and cryptocurrencies-- to deal with varied regional preferences. At the same time, the risk team acts as the digital gatekeeper. They need to promptly compare a genuine- high-roller and a bad actor attempting to launder cash or make use of advertising loopholes (referred to as"benefit abuse"). Advanced AI tools analyze transactional behavior in real-time
